What do pimps, star chambers, ratbags and Westphalians have in common? Answer: they’ve all featured in Australian parliamentary debates about racial discrimination. An article I’ve written with colleagues for Australian Journal of Politics & History
Tweet card summary image
onlinelibrary.wiley.com
Australian public debates about race have featured intense contests about free speech and identity, including about the federal Racial Discrimination Act (RDA). While these developments may be...
